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
金沢アプリ開発塾セミナー資料「テストについて」
Search
Tomokazu Kiyohara
February 20, 2018
Programming
1
240
金沢アプリ開発塾セミナー資料「テストについて」
2017年度 金沢アプリ開発塾 2月 セミナー資料
Tomokazu Kiyohara
February 20, 2018
Tweet
Share
More Decks by Tomokazu Kiyohara
See All by Tomokazu Kiyohara
首負担皆無!ゼログラビティ プログラミングスタイル
kiyohara
0
320
北陸で Ruby なお仕事に携わるための3つの戦略
kiyohara
1
1.6k
Algolia in CAMPFIRE
kiyohara
0
3.5k
地方エンジニアの日常 - 業務からコミュニティ活動まで
kiyohara
0
260
Web to macOS native app
kiyohara
0
350
Git インフラ選定事例 - 株式会社クルウィットが GitHub を選んだ理由
kiyohara
0
470
ベッドで技術書を快適に読むただひとつの方法
kiyohara
19
23k
JavaScript で OS X を自動操作
kiyohara
1
470
Web API をデバックするときに必要なたったひとつのこと
kiyohara
1
340
Other Decks in Programming
See All in Programming
Jakarta EE meets AI
ivargrimstad
0
160
cmp.Or に感動した
otakakot
3
210
RubyLSPのマルチバイト文字対応
notfounds
0
120
受け取る人から提供する人になるということ
little_rubyist
0
250
Streams APIとTCPフロー制御 / Web Streams API and TCP flow control
tasshi
2
350
見せてあげますよ、「本物のLaravel批判」ってやつを。
77web
7
7.8k
.NET のための通信フレームワーク MagicOnion 入門 / Introduction to MagicOnion
mayuki
1
1.7k
TypeScript Graph でコードレビューの心理的障壁を乗り越える
ysk8hori
3
1.2k
Quine, Polyglot, 良いコード
qnighy
4
650
카카오페이는 어떻게 수천만 결제를 처리할까? 우아한 결제 분산락 노하우
kakao
PRO
0
110
Remix on Hono on Cloudflare Workers
yusukebe
1
300
React への依存を最小にするフロントエンド設計
takonda
5
1.1k
Featured
See All Featured
Building Your Own Lightsaber
phodgson
103
6.1k
[Rails World 2023 - Day 1 Closing Keynote] - The Magic of Rails
eileencodes
33
1.9k
Into the Great Unknown - MozCon
thekraken
32
1.5k
Building Adaptive Systems
keathley
38
2.3k
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
27
4.3k
Rebuilding a faster, lazier Slack
samanthasiow
79
8.7k
GraphQLとの向き合い方2022年版
quramy
43
13k
Facilitating Awesome Meetings
lara
50
6.1k
Optimizing for Happiness
mojombo
376
70k
A designer walks into a library…
pauljervisheath
204
24k
KATA
mclloyd
29
14k
The Pragmatic Product Professional
lauravandoore
31
6.3k
Transcript
ςετ $PEFGPS,BOB[BXBਗ਼ݪஐ ۚΞϓϦ։ൃक़
͚͠Μʲࢼݧʳ ⽡໊ɾεଞ⽢ͷੑ࣭ྗͳͲΛͨΊ͢͜ͱɺ·ͨݕࠪ͢ Δ͜ͱɻʮੑʕʯɻಛʹɺਓͷࣝɾೳྗΛௐΔͨΊʹɺ Λग़ͯ͑ͤ͠͞Δ͜ͱɻʮೖֶʕʯ ςετ ؠ ࠃޠࣙయ ୈࣣ൛ ৽൛ ΑΓҾ༻
༷ʹͳ͍ৼ·ͨܽؕΛ ݟ͚ͭग़͢࡞ۀͷ͜ͱ ιϑτΣΞςετ Wikipedia ΑΓҾ༻
͞·͟·ͳςετ w ࣌ظʢ͍ͭͨΊ͔͢ʣ w ରʢͳʹΛͨΊ͔͢ʣ w ख๏ʢͲ͏ͬͯͨΊ͔͢ʣ w Έ߹ΘͤʹΑͬͯ͞·͟·
͞·͟·ͳςετ w ࣌ظʢ͍ͭͨΊ͔͢ʣ w ରʢͳʹΛͨΊ͔͢ʣ w ख๏ʢͲ͏ͬͯͨΊ͔͢ʣ w Έ߹ΘͤʹΑͬͯ͞·͟·
7Ϟσϧ ɹ Wikipedia ΑΓҾ༻
εΫϥϜ w ςετۦಈ։ൃ w ϦϑΝΫλϦϯά w ܧଓతΠϯςάϨʔγϣϯ
͞·͟·ͳςετ w ࣌ظʢ͍ͭͨΊ͔͢ʣ w ରʢͳʹΛͨΊ͔͢ʣ w ख๏ʢͲ͏ͬͯͨΊ͔͢ʣ w Έ߹ΘͤʹΑͬͯ͞·͟·
ର w ػೳςετ w ੑೳςετʢύϑΥʔϚϯεςετʣ w ෛՙςετʢετϨεςετʣ w ϢʔβϏϦςΟςετ w
ηΩϡϦςΟςετ
͞·͟·ͳςετ w ࣌ظʢ͍ͭͨΊ͔͢ʣ w ରʢͳʹΛͨΊ͔͢ʣ w ख๏ʢͲ͏ͬͯͨΊ͔͢ʣ w Έ߹ΘͤʹΑͬͯ͞·͟·
ख๏ w ੩తςετ w ಈతςετ w ϒϥοΫϘοΫεςετ w ϗϫΠτϘοΫεςετ
੩తςετɾಈతςετ w ੩తςετ w ओʹίʔυΛରͱͨ͠ςετ w ίʔυϨϏϡʔ੩తղੳπʔϧΛ͍ͪΔ w ಈతςετ w
ίʔυ͔Βੜ͞ΕͨιϑτΣΞΛಈ࡞ͤͯ͞ߦ͏ςετ w ਓखʹΑΔࢹ֬ೝʢQSJOUGEFCVH w ͞·͟·ͳςετπʔϧΛ͍ͪΔʢޙड़ʣ
ಈతςετͷςετ߲ w ಈతςετɺιϑτΣΞʹରͯ͠ʮͳʹΛೖྗͨ͠ Βʯʮͳʹ͕ग़ྗ͞ΕΔʯ͔ΛͨΊ͢͜ͱ w ʮςετ߲ʯ㲈ʮͳʹΛೖྗͨ͠ΒʯΛͲ͏ܾΊΔ͔
ϒϥοΫϘοΫεςετ w ֎෦༷͔ΒೖྗΛܾΊΔํࣜ w ιϑτΣΞ͕෦ͰͲͷΑ͏ͳॲཧΛ͍ͯ͠Δ͔Λ ߟ͑ͳ͍ʢϒϥοΫϘοΫεʣ
ϗϫΠτϘοΫεςετ w ෦ߏ͔ΒೖྗΛܾΊΔํࣜ w ͲͷΑ͏ͳϩδοΫʹͳ͍ͬͯΔ͔ɺιʔείʔυͷ ༰ʹԠͯ͡ςετ߲ΛܾΊ͍ͯ͘
ϒϥοΫˍϗϫΠτ w ϒϥοΫϘοΫε w ίʔυमਖ਼ϦϑΝΫλϦϯάͷରԠ͢͠͞ w ϗϫΠτϘοΫε w ಈ࡞ෆඋͷݕग़͢͠͞
ೖྗͷબఆ w ಉׂ w ग़ྗ͕ಉ͡ʹͳΔೖྗͷάϧʔϐϯάͱදͱͳΔೖ ྗΛܾఆ͢ΔͨΊͷख๏ w ڥքੳ w
ग़ྗ͕ҟͳΔೖྗͷڥքʢPOP⒎ϙΠϯτʣʹண͠ ͯೖྗΛܾఆ͢ΔͨΊͷख๏ ϒϥοΫϗϫΠτ
ೖྗͷબఆ w ΧόϨοδʢཏʣ w εςʔτϝϯτΧόϨοδʢ໋ྩཏʣ w ϒϥϯνΧόϨοδʢذཏʣ w ίϯσΟγϣϯΧόϨοδʢ݅ཏʣ
ϗϫΠτ
NPSF w *40*&$*&&& w ιϑτΣΞςετͷࠃࡍඪ४ن֨ w IUUQXXXTPGUXBSFUFTUJOHTUBOEBSEPSH ˞༗໊ͳ*&&&จॻͷΈΛରͱ͍ͯ͠Δ͕ɺ*40*&$*&&&༻ޠɾϓϩηεɾจॻɾٕ๏ͱશൠΛରͱ͍ͯ͠Δ
"OESPJEΞϓϦ։ൃͱςετ
"OESPJE%FWFMPQFST 5FTUJOH"QQTPO"OESPJE IUUQTEFWFMPQFSBOESPJEDPNUSBJOJOHUFTUJOHJOEFYIUNM
"OESPJE4UVEJP ΞϓϦͷςετ IUUQTEFWFMPQFSBOESPJEDPNTUVEJPUFTUJOEFYIUNM
2JJUB "OESPJEςετϋϯζΦϯ IUUQTRJJUBDPNDBUUBLBJUFNTGBDFGFGD
·ͱΊ w ߴ࣭ͷΞϓϦߴ࣭ͷςετͰग़དྷ͍ͯΔ w ιϑτΣΞςετʹ͞·͟·ͳ؍ͱٕ๏͕͋Δ w "OESPJEΞϓϦ։ൃ༻ͷʮςετπʔϧʯ͕͋Δ
ࠓͷۚΞϓϦ։ൃक़ ͋ͱগ͠Ͱ͢ ࠷ޙͷ͍ࠐΈΛ͕Μ͍ͬͯͩ͘͞